For the development, optimization, and comparison of controller-models for the human operator a systematic method is proposed. This is suitable for any designed model, even multi-parameter systems. A random search technique is chosen for the parameter optimization. As valuation criteria for the quality of the model-development the criterion function, the comparison between the input and output functions of the human operator and those of the model, and the most important characteristic values and functions of the statistical signal theory (mean values, auto-and cross-correlation functions, histograms, and power density functions) are used.
